10000 contenu connexe trouvé
Accélérer les applications existantes avec un cache redis
Présentation de l'article:Redis accélère les applications existantes: requêtes de cache pour réduire la charge du serveur
Points de base:
Redis accélère efficacement les applications existantes en mettant en cache les résultats de la requête, réduisant ainsi le stress du serveur. Il stocke les résultats de requête pendant une période spécifiée (par exemple, 24 heures), puis réutilise ces résultats, améliorant considérablement la vitesse d'application.
L'installation de Redis peut être effectuée via le gestionnaire de package du système d'exploitation ou manuellement. Le processus d'installation comprend d'éviter les avertissements communs et de s'assurer que Redis démarre automatiquement après le redémarrage du serveur.
La bibliothèque Predis fonctionne avec Redis pour fournir une couche de cache de mémoire pour les applications. Ce processus consiste à vérifier si les résultats de la requête actuelle existent dans le cache, sinon, obtenez le résultat et transférez-le
2025-02-17
commentaire 0
414
Laravel Cache Optimisation: Redis et Memcached Configuration Guide
Présentation de l'article:Dans Laravel, Redis et Memcached peuvent être utilisés pour optimiser les politiques de mise en cache. 1) Pour configurer Redis ou Memcached, vous devez définir les paramètres de connexion dans le fichier .env. 2) Redis prend en charge une variété de structures de données et de persistance, adaptées à des scénarios et des scénarios complexes à haut risque de perte de données; Memcached convient à un accès rapide à des données simples. 3) Utilisez Cachefacade pour effectuer des opérations de cache unifiées et la couche sous-jacente sélectionnera automatiquement le backend de cache configuré.
2025-04-30
commentaire 0
606
Que faire si le cache Redis échoue dans Spring Boot?
Présentation de l'article:Dans Springboot, utilisez Redis pour mettre en cache l'objet OAuth2Authorisation. Dans l'application Springboot, utilisez SpringSecurityoAuth2AuthorizationsServer ...
2025-04-19
commentaire 0
1256
Redis as Cache vs Datastore: compromis.
Présentation de l'article:L'article traite des compromis de l'utilisation de Redis comme cache par rapport au montant de données, en se concentrant sur les performances, la persistance des données et les implications d'évolutivité.
2025-03-26
commentaire 0
545
Redis pour la mise en cache: amélioration des performances des applications Web
Présentation de l'article:L'utilisation de Redis comme couche de cache peut améliorer considérablement les performances des applications Web. 1) Redis réduit le nombre de requêtes de base de données et améliore la vitesse d'accès aux données en stockant les données en mémoire. 2) Redis prend en charge plusieurs structures de données pour obtenir un cache plus flexible. 3) Lorsque vous utilisez Redis, vous devez faire attention au taux de réussite du cache, à la stratégie de défaillance et à la cohérence des données. 4) L'optimisation des performances comprend la sélection des structures de données appropriées, la configuration des stratégies de cache est raisonnablement, en utilisant le fragment et le clustering, la surveillance et le réglage.
2025-04-02
commentaire 0
966
Méthodes d'implémentation de l'accélération du cache dans PHP et MySQL combinées avec Redis
Présentation de l'article:Redis est nécessaire pour accélérer la combinaison de PHP et MySQL, car Redis peut augmenter considérablement la vitesse d'accès aux données et réduire la charge de requête de la base de données. Les méthodes spécifiques incluent: 1. Cache MySQL Results Results en redis pour réduire le nombre de requêtes directes; 2. Utilisez le mode ou la transaction publié sur la sous-estimation pour assurer la cohérence du cache; 3. Empêcher la pénétration du cache à travers les filtres de floraison; 4. Réglez différents temps d'expiration ou utilisez des verrous distribués pour éviter les avalanches de cache; 5. Implémentez le cache hiérarchique, l'échauffement des données et les stratégies d'ajustement dynamique pour optimiser davantage les performances.
2025-05-28
commentaire 0
467
Cache une base de données MongoDB avec redis
Présentation de l'article:Ce didacticiel montre comment augmenter les performances d'un service Web Node.js interagissant avec une base de données MongoDB en implémentant une couche de mise en cache Redis. Nous allons créer une application "FastLibrary" pour illustrer le concept.
Avantages clés o
2025-02-19
commentaire 0
1160
Comment mettre en ?uvre des stratégies d'invalidation du cache dans Redis?
Présentation de l'article:L'article traite des stratégies de mise en ?uvre et de gestion de l'invalidation du cache dans Redis, y compris l'expiration basée sur le temps, les méthodes axées sur les événements et le versioning. Il couvre également les meilleures pratiques pour l'expiration du cache et les outils pour la surveillance et l'automate
2025-03-17
commentaire 0
914
Comment construire un système de mise en cache distribué avec Nginx et Redis?
Présentation de l'article:Cet article détaille la construction d'un système de mise en cache distribué à l'aide de Nginx et Redis. Il couvre la configuration de l'infrastructure, la configuration de Nginx (en tant qu'équilibreur proxy / charge inverse) et Redis, l'intégration d'application et les considérations de performances cruciales
2025-03-12
commentaire 0
1095
Comment utiliser les annotations redis
Présentation de l'article:Use the Redis annotation mechanism to simplify Redis interaction in Java code, providing the following annotation type: @Cacheable: Cache method returns a value @CachePut: Put the value into the cache after the method is executed @CacheableEvict: Clear the cache entry before and after the method is executed @EnableCaching: Enable cache support @RedisHash: Define Redis hash @RedisValue: Declare Redis value
2025-04-10
commentaire 0
601
Redis: rationalisation du traitement et de la mise en cache des données
Présentation de l'article:Redis simplifie les méthodes de traitement et de mise en cache des données, notamment: 1) Support de structure de données multifonctionnels, 2) Mode de publication de publication, 3) Stockage de la mémoire et structure de données efficace, 4) Mécanisme de persistance. Grace à ces fonctionnalités, Redis peut améliorer les performances et l'efficacité des applications.
2025-04-09
commentaire 0
736
Comment résoudre le problème de la répartition du cache redis
Présentation de l'article:Solution de répartition du cache Redis: Ajoutez un mutex: acquérir un verrou distribué avant d'interroger la base de données pour éviter les requêtes simultanées. Cache de mise à jour asynchrones: placez les opérations de mise à jour du cache dans la file d'attente pour exécuter de manière asynchrone pour éviter les mises à jour simultanées. Les données sur hotspot ne sont jamais expirées: définissez un long temps d'expiration pour les données de hotspot ou n'expirez jamais pour éviter la rupture du cache. Limite actuelle: Contr?lez le nombre de demandes d'accès à la base de données pour empêcher l'accès simultané de provoquer une pression de base de données excessive. Utilisez le filtre Bloom: déterminez rapidement s'il existe la valeur. S'il existe, il renvoie des données mises en cache. S'il n'existe pas, il interroge la base de données.
2025-04-10
commentaire 0
873
Intégration de Redis à Django pour une mise en cache haute performance
Présentation de l'article:Dans les applications Web modernes, les performances et la réactivité sont cruciales. à mesure que le trafic augmente, la demande en matière de traitement efficace des données et de temps de réponse rapides augmente. L'utilisation de Redis avec Django pour la mise en cache peut améliorer considérablement les performances des applications
2024-11-06
commentaire 0
804
Application du filtre Redis Bloom dans la protection de la pénétration du cache
Présentation de l'article:Utilisez le filtre Bloom pour protéger la pénétration du cache car il peut rapidement déterminer si un élément peut exister, intercepter les demandes inexistantes et protéger la base de données. Le filtre Redis Bloom juge efficacement l'existence d'éléments par une faible utilisation de la mémoire, intercepte avec succès les demandes non valides et réduit la pression de la base de données. Malgré le taux de mauvaise évaluation, une telle erreur de jugement est acceptable dans la protection de la pénétration du cache.
2025-06-04
commentaire 0
587
Redis: mise en cache, gestion de session, et plus encore
Présentation de l'article:Les fonctions de Redis incluent principalement le cache, la gestion de session et d'autres fonctions: 1) les fonctions de cache stocke les données via la mémoire pour améliorer la vitesse de lecture, et convient aux scénarios d'accès haute fréquence tels que les sites Web de commerce électronique; 2) La fonction de gestion de session partage les données de session dans un système distribué et le nettoie automatiquement via un mécanisme de temps d'expiration; 3) D'autres fonctions telles que le mode de publication-subscription, les verrous et les comptoirs distribués, adaptés à la poussée de messages en temps réel et aux systèmes multi-thread et autres scénarios.
2025-05-01
commentaire 0
347